Venezuelan actress who is known for her work in television series, feature films, and made for TV movies. She is most recognized for her role as Margaret in the 2010 feature film The Zero Hour. She is also known for her recurring role in the 2009 series Los Misterios de Amor.
Her acting career first began in 1996 when she starred as the character Tita in the made for TV film Long Cours. After appearing in several films, she earned further recognition in 2001 with the recurring role of Carmen in Planeta de 6.
She is known for also being the official voice of E! Entertainment's Latin American edition.
She was born and raised in Maracaibo, Zulia, Venezuela.
She starred alongside Laureano Olivares in the 2010 film The Zero Hour.
